Club ‘serious’ about bombshell dream team
Rugby league great Phil Gould has revealed the Cronulla Sharks are “serious” about landing a superstar coaching trio consisting of Roosters assistant Craig Fitzgibbon, Penrith assistant Cameron Ciraldo and Storm coach Craig Bellamy.
The Sharks are currently in the middle of a contract standoff with current coach John Morris, who is off-contract at the end of the season, and held a 90-minute crisis meeting on Monday after reports linking the club to Fitzgibbon emerged on the weekend.
